## Validator Plugins — Getting Started

New validators for the Corven pipeline ship as plugins loaded by the Sievewright host at startup. Each plugin declares its schema targets in a manifest; the host handles ordering and retries, so keep your validator pure and fast. During local development you'll run the host against the staging registry, which requires authentication. Ask your onboarding buddy before testing against anything else. The key for the registry service is below.

app token of yajof-fajof = zpat11_OrsDd3gqCaG

Pagination issues on the Lark public REST API usually mean cursor expiry or a skewed page-size default after deploy. Check the cursor TTL config first, then the per-tenant overrides in Fennel. Do not bump max page size without capacity review. The full pagination runbook and rollback steps are on the internal page here.

wiki page, bagaf-fawip: https://harbor.tolvaqsys.local/pages/repo/pages/secrets/eac969ffc71f356b

## Releases

Welcome to Plotfinder, our address autocomplete widget! Releases go out roughly every two weeks. You'll bump the version in `widget.json`, run the build, and let CI handle packaging. Don't publish from your laptop — the pipeline does it for a reason. New folks: ask Marguerite before tagging anything. One last thing: every published bundle has to be signed so partner sites can verify it, and we sign with the key below.

signing key of baduf-taweg = bky6_Zf7bem